fix: Solve space issues in VG→Borg backups

Problem: VG→Borg was creating temp files for all LVs simultaneously,
causing 'no space left' errors when LVs are large.

Solution: Process LVs sequentially instead of simultaneously:
1. Create snapshot for one LV
2. Stream it directly to Borg (no temp files)
3. Remove snapshot immediately
4. Move to next LV

Changes:
- VG→Borg now creates separate archives per LV instead of one big archive
- Each LV gets its own archive: vg_internal-vg_lv_root_20241009_123456
- No temporary files needed - direct streaming
- Space-efficient: only one snapshot exists at a time
- More robust: failure of one LV doesn't affect others

Benefits:
- No more space issues regardless of LV sizes
- Faster cleanup between LVs
- Individual LV recovery possible
- Better error isolation
- Still preserves block-level backup benefits
